Power Hardware-in-the-Loop Simulation to Verify Protection Coordination for DC Microgrid

In this work, power hardware-in-the-loop (PHIL) simulation was used to explore the protection coordination of solid-state-circuit-breakers (SSCB) with conventional mechanical circuit-breakers (CB) within a DC microgrid. The system of interest (SOD includes diesel generators, AC loads, DC loads, power converters and battery-based and ultra-capacitor-based energy storage. The system also includes a mix of current-limiting converters and passive sources of fault current contribution. Using PHIL simulation, the generators, loads, power converters, and the developed circuit-protection-control were simulated on a real-time simulator and interfaced to the hardware-of-interest (HOD which included developed SSCBs and CBs. Multiple experiments were executed to explore the operation of fast-acting SSCBs in conjunction with conventional switchboard-oriented protection in a system.
